On the eastern shore of Lake George in Putnam County, Florida, Pine Island Campground and Marina offers the rare combination of direct lake access, a working marina, and comfortable RV accommodations on one of the most ecologically significant lakes in the St. Johns River system. Lake George—the second-largest lake in Florida—sits at the heart of a waterway network that connects springs, river channels, and wildlife refuges, and Pine Island's position on that network makes it one of the most compelling water-access RV parks in Central Florida. Whether your priorities run toward bass fishing, spring-fed swimming holes, or simply watching the morning light come across the lake, this is a campground that rewards guests who use the water. RV sites with 30 and 50-amp full hookup service are complemented by individual fire pits and picnic tables, coin-operated laundry, clean shower facilities, and a dump station centrally located for convenience. The marina operation adds a layer of capability that typical campgrounds can't offer: 20 covered boat slips, a boat ramp with easy launch access, pontoon rental, kayak rentals, and ethanol-free fuel on-site. A 22-foot Lexington pontoon is available for full-day rental—the preferred choice for guests heading to Silver Glen Springs, exploring the wildlife refuges along the lake, or seeking waterfront dining options accessible only by boat. A coffee and bait counter and camp store round out the daily convenience needs. Tiny house lakefront accommodations are available for guests who prefer to forgo the RV setup. Lake George is a landscape of exceptional ecological richness. The lake sits within the Ocala National Forest waterway system and provides access to Silver Glen Springs—one of the iconic first-magnitude springs of the Florida system—along with Alexander Springs, Juniper Springs, and the broad, tannin-dark waters of the St. Johns River itself. Manatee sightings near the springs are common in cooler months, and the lake's bird life—ospreys, bald eagles, great blue herons, and wading birds of every variety—provides constant entertainment for guests who keep binoculars on the picnic table. The broader Lake George region offers a historical depth that complements the natural setting well. The Ocala National Forest, one of the nation's oldest national forests, surrounds the waterway with hiking trails, off-road opportunities, and some of the most extensive longleaf pine restoration in the Southeast. The town of Palatka is within reasonable range for provisioning and historical exploration, and the Spring-to-Spring Trail connects multiple natural springs through the forest. Crescent City, Deland, and the St. Johns River corridor provide additional day-trip destinations for guests who want to range beyond the lake. Pine Island Campground and Marina operates year-round in the warm Central Florida climate, and each season brings distinct character. Winter is prime manatee season at the springs, spring and fall offer the best bass fishing conditions on Lake George, and summer brings the full subtropical lushness that makes Florida's freshwater corridor so distinctive.
